Is My Air Conditioner Working?
It can be challenging to tell if your air conditioner is working in the summer heat. Your AC system should cool air temperatures by at least 20°. If you start the system in a hot house on a 100° day, the initial air may still feel warm. However, as long as you get that 20° drop, the system is probably working correctly. As it cools the air, it will intake cooler air, which will drop the air temperature coming out of the vents. It may take several hours or even a whole day to cool a hot house in Kingwood, TX to your desired temperature.
Steps to Check Before Calling Our Kingwood, TX Crew
We provide a full range of AC repair, service, and maintenance in Kingwood, TX and surrounding areas. We are happy to handle all of your service needs. However, if you want to save time and money on your AC repairs, take the following steps before giving us a call.
Check your power
Check to make sure you have the unit on, that the power supply at the unit is on, and that your circuit breaker has not tripped. Power surges in Kingwood, TX can cause you to lose power to your AC unit. However, if your circuit breaker repeatedly trips, it may indicate an electrical problem in your unit requiring repair or maintenance.
Check your drip pan
Water will collect in your drip pan or under your unit if your condensate line is clogged. Many newer units in the Kingwood area have water sensors that will shut them down if they detect water. If you are handy, you may be able to flush out your drain line and get your Kingwood, TX AC working without a service call.
Check your batteries
If your Kingwood, TX thermostat does not seem to be working, see if it is a battery-operated model. Try changing the batteries to see if that gets your system working.
Check your filters
Dirty filters block airflow. If your Kingwood, TX system appears to be blowing less air or the air is humid and warm, the problem could be as simple as dirty filters.
Do I Need AC Repair in Kingwood, TX?
Sometimes, you know you need an air conditioner repair in Kingwood, TX. Other times, you may wonder if your air conditioner is struggling. Often, there are warning signs before your AC completely fails. Call to schedule service or repair if you notice any of these signs in your Kingwood, TX home.
Weird Smells
Your Kingwood, TX air conditioning system should not smell funny. If you notice any unusual moldy, chemical, or burning odors, turn off the unit and call for service. However, if you have a combined air conditioning and heating HVAC system, strange smells are expected when you first turn on your heater. That smell is burning dust and should only happen the first two or three times your heat comes on each season.
Drainage Changes
Your Kingwood, TX HVAC system should drain directly into a pipe. There is an overflow condensate drain in many homes that goes outside the house if the standard drain is clogged. If you see water coming out of that little pipe, it is a sign that your main condensate drain is blocked. Your unit’s AC drain pan should also empty at a constant rate. If you notice any changes in drainage, you want to fix them to prevent floods in your Kingwood home.
Humidity Changes
Air conditioners change air humidity as they cool. If you notice your Kingwood home feels more humid than usual, it could be a warning sign of an AC problem.
Reduced Air Flow
When your system is running, you should feel air coming from the vents. If you cannot feel air or if it feels weaker than usual, have us check it out in your Kingwood, TX home.
